Базовые-принципы функционирования PowerShell

posted in: Uncategorized 0

Базовые-принципы функционирования PowerShell

PowerShell образует по-сути инструмент командной строки и инструмент скриптов, разработанный с-целью автоматического-выполнения операций плюс контроля системой. PowerShell применяется ради запуска инструкций, настройки системной среды, обслуживания компонентов и передачи данных. В-отличие сравнение по-сравнению-с традиционных консольных интерфейсов, Windows-PowerShell функционирует не-исключительно лишь через строками, при-этом а-также со структурами, данный-фактор расширяет возможности 1xbet анализа а-также управления.

В нынешних инфраструктурах Windows-PowerShell задействуется для упрощения повседневных действий а-также разработки системных сценариев. Во практических разборах плюс прикладных случаях, среди-них 1xbet, регулярно демонстрируется, как посредством применением PowerShell-среды реально управлять файлами, службами а-также network настройками без использования графического UI.

Главные принципы функционирования Windows-PowerShell

PowerShell-среда построен на-основе модели встроенных-команд — небольших системных команд, любая среди них закрывает точную задачу. Cmdlet-команды получают типовую форму имен, как-правило состоящую с-помощью глагола а-также названия-объекта. Данный подход формирует операции более логичными плюс структурированными.

Каждый встроенная-команда передает результат, но не-просто текстовую запись. Это означает, когда ответ реально направлять в следующие операции без-применения дополнительной преобразования. Подобный механизм позволяет строить последовательности операций, внутри которых информация согласованно проверяются несколькими механизмами.

Использование в Windows-PowerShell организуется посредством поэтапного проведения операций. Пользователь а-также скрипт определяет операции, а система выполняет действия в заданном сценарии. За-счет такой-логике реально разрабатывать цепочки, они без-ручного-участия запускают многоступенчатые операции без-ручного прямого участия 1хбет.

Cmdlet-команды и их схема

Командлеты выступают базой PowerShell. Командлеты содержат стандартизированный шаблон обозначения, например Get-Process, Set-Location либо Remove-Item. Первая-часть указывает команду, и объект указывает ресурс, с которым данное операция проводится.

Командлеты способны использовать аргументы, они конкретизируют сценарий запуска. Допустим, возможно задать конкретный документ, директорию либо операцию. Настройки помогают подстроить 1xbet зеркало операцию под-нужную конкретную задачу плюс создают процесс более гибкой.

Итог запуска cmdlet-команды возможно сохранить в переменную или передать дальше по конвейеру. Подобная-возможность позволяет соединять команды плюс разрабатывать намного развитые скрипты, сформированные на-основе нескольких шагов.

Работа через данными

Ключевой в-числе важных черт Windows-PowerShell является обработка со объектами. В-отличие разницу от традиционных оболочек, в-которых операции передают символы, PowerShell-среда передает упорядоченные объекты. Каждый элемент имеет параметры и методы, что реально использовать для последующей передачи.

Допустим, после загрузке перечня операций система передает не просто текстовые-строки с названиями, а структуры со информацией об каждом 1xbet элементе. Подобная-модель помогает сортировать, упорядочивать а-также корректировать объекты без-применения дополнительных конвертаций.

Взаимодействие через структурами оптимизирует анализ сведений а-также формирует сценарии намного корректными. Возможно получать лишь требуемые параметры, запускать сравнения и задействовать правила без-применения многоэтапных операций с символами.

Конвейер PowerShell-среды

Цепочка позволяет направлять вывод первой команды в иную. Данный-механизм одна среди важных инструментов PowerShell. Посредством pipeline помощью реально соединять ряд операций во общую последовательность, где любая инструкция преобразует данные, принятые от прошлой.

Данный механизм делает скрипты лаконичными а-также ясными. Взамен подготовки временных документов либо контейнеров возможно непосредственно отправлять результат следом. Подобная-логика ускоряет запуск операций а-также уменьшает частоту 1хбет сбоев.

Цепочка регулярно используется во-время сортировки информации, получении нужных записей и проведении последовательных операций. Конвейер является значимой частью структуры функционирования PowerShell.

Значения и сохранение сведений

Переменные в PowerShell используются для записи сведений, она способна использоваться применена впоследствии. Такие-значения задаются знаком доллар а-также имеют-возможность содержать несколько типы данных, включая строки, числа, наборы плюс структуры.

Задействование значений позволяет фиксировать временные выводы и оптимизирует работу со сложными цепочками. Взамен повторного проведения той-же плюс той же команды реально зафиксировать результат плюс использовать его еще-раз.

Значения еще помогают структурировать код плюс создают его значительно ясным. Такая-возможность в-особенности необходимо 1xbet зеркало во-время подготовке объемных цепочек, когда необходимо контролировать множеством значений.

Командные-файлы во Windows-PowerShell

PowerShell-среда позволяет создание скриптов — документов со расширением .ps1, содержащих набор команд. Командные-файлы позволяют упростить задачи плюс проводить задачи многократно без-ручного самостоятельного ввода.

Сценарии могут включать условия, итерации и функции. Подобная-структура делает сценарии полноценным инструментом для закрытия развитых задач. Сценарии задействуются для подготовки платформ, анализа информации а-также выполнения регулярных задач.

Перед запуском сценариев необходимо проверять настройки безопасности системы. PowerShell-среда 1xbet способна ограничивать запуск сценариев для защиты против опасного кода. Из-за-этого важно правильно задавать политики а-также применять исключительно надежные сценарии.

Селекция а-также преобразование информации

PowerShell-среда предоставляет инструменты для селекции плюс анализа сведений. С-помощью их помощью возможно выбирать исключительно нужные данные, распределять их плюс проводить многочисленные процессы.

Фильтрация дает-возможность сократить количество данных а-также сконцентрироваться на значимых объектах. Это 1хбет в-частности важно во-время работе при большими списками процессов или информации.

Обработка информации может включать преобразование форматов, сведение параметров плюс запуск операций. Такие процессы обычно используются в оптимизации плюс исследовании.

Операции со каталогами а-также средой

PowerShell-среда широко используется с-целью контроля файлами а-также папками. Посредством его применением можно создавать, удалять, смещать и обновлять файлы. Также возможно просматривать контент папок 1xbet зеркало а-также выполнять сканирование.

Кроме работы через данными, Windows-PowerShell помогает контролировать процессами, операциями плюс параметрами платформы. Такая-возможность делает PowerShell практичным средством для администрирования.

Скрипты способны самостоятельно запускать дублирующее сохранение, чистить временные каталоги и контролировать операции внутри системе. Подобная-логика помогает обеспечивать стабильность а-также корректность функционирования.

Удаленное администрирование

Windows-PowerShell поддерживает сетевое запуск инструкций. Такая-функция дает-возможность контролировать удаленными устройствами а-также хостами без-прямого локального взаимодействия ко системам. Подобный механизм широко используется для 1xbet организационных инфраструктурах.

Удаленное администрирование дает-возможность запускать операции с-одного-узла. Допустим, можно обновить программное ПО на разных компьютерах параллельно либо проверить их.

Для-работы в сетевом режиме-работы задействуются отдельные механизмы плюс настройки безопасности. Это гарантирует сохранность данных плюс управление возможностей.

Безопасность Windows-PowerShell

Windows-PowerShell содержит средства контроля, которые ограничивают выполнение командных-файлов. Это необходимо для защиты-от исполнения опасных скриптов. Среда способна запрашивать цифровую подтверждение или право на-выполнение запуск скриптов.

Критично контролировать принципы защиты при работе через PowerShell-средой. Не-рекомендуется 1хбет запускать непроверенные файлы плюс настраивать конфигурации без-понимания учета последствий.

Контроль прав плюс анализ файлов помогают снизить угрозы а-также создают надежную работу платформы. Корректное взаимодействие PowerShell-среды является ключевой частью администрирования.

Практическое применение PowerShell

PowerShell-среда используется внутри различных областях, содержа управление, создание-решений плюс обработку данных. PowerShell дает-возможность ускорять операции, администрировать 1xbet зеркало платформами и передавать данные.

Посредством PowerShell использованием реально генерировать отчеты, настраивать среду, администрировать аккаунтами и проводить развитые задачи. Такая-возможность формирует PowerShell-среду универсальным механизмом для взаимодействия с средой.

Гибкость а-также настраиваемость позволяют настраивать PowerShell-среду под-конкретные конкретные цели. Инструмент сохраняется популярным инструментом внутри нынешних IT инфраструктурах.

Дополнительные возможности и модули

PowerShell позволяет дополнение возможностей посредством счет расширений. Расширение образует по-сути совокупность cmdlet-команд, инструментов а-также средств, собранных во единый набор. С-помощью расширений помощью можно внедрять дополнительные возможности без изменения главной среды. К-примеру, имеются расширения для интеграции через облачными системами, системами информации 1xbet а-также сетевыми механизмами.

Загрузка модулей дает-возможность использовать дополнительные командлеты настолько же удобно, подобно стандартные инструменты. Такая-возможность формирует PowerShell настраиваемым а-также адаптируемым под-разные многочисленные сценарии. Специалисты плюс создатели имеют-возможность формировать собственные расширения, что отвечают конкретным задачам инфраструктуры.

Дополнительно Windows-PowerShell поддерживает сохранение журналов а-также фиксацию-событий. Скрипты способны сохранять информацию о исполнении, записывать исключения плюс записывать ответы действий. Данный-механизм значимо для оценки, исправления а-также проверки процессов. Записи дают-возможность разобраться, какие действия выполнялись плюс в какой-точной 1хбет цепочке.

Исключения плюс их устранение

В-процессе взаимодействии через скриптами могут возникать ошибки, вызванные со доступом, отсутствием ресурсов или неправильными параметрами. PowerShell предоставляет инструменты устранения подобных ситуаций. Сценарий имеет-возможность контролировать параметры исполнения и реагировать на сбои.

Обработка исключений позволяет исключить срыва исполнения а-также поддерживает надежную эксплуатацию. Сценарий может отобразить предупреждение, сохранить ошибку в журнал либо провести запасное операцию. Подобная-логика создает автоматизацию более предсказуемой плюс предсказуемой.

Грамотная обработка со ошибками особенно критична для многоэтапных сценариях, в-которых подключено большое-количество модулей. Учет исключений позволяет обеспечить корректность данных плюс правильность завершения операций 1xbet зеркало.